Hello all. Newbie here.

I have installed a SH-182M but it won't read a CD and is showing up on "My Computer" as a DVD-RAM drive. Looks like it is setting up my D: drive an empty version of my C: hard drive.

Device Manager says my SH-182M is installed and working but I just can't find in "My Computer" and the drive won't read CD's or DVD's.

If I uninstall the DVD-RAM drive through Device Manager and re-start my computer it looks for new hardware as a CD-ROM drive, then sets it up as a DVD-RAM drive.

I've narrowed the problem down to the following:

- I checked the jumper settings. Tried both cable-select and separate master/slave settings. Neither works.
- The drive will read and play DVD's but will not read commercial CD's or a blank. I've tried several different CD's. Some are not recognized. Others spin and the light blinks constantly, but nothing happens. It just freezes the PC until I eject and remove the CD.

So the drive can handle DVD media, but not CD media? Since this sounds like a bad drive, contact your dealer for a replacement under warranty.

I called Samsung and they said the same thing. I wasn't aware that there were two different pick-up mechanisms.

Samsung has offered to give me a replacement.
